Ardmore Ogham Stone:
LUGUDECCAS MAQỊ/ ̣ ̣? ̣ ̣MU]/COI NETA-SEGAMONAS/ DOLATI BIGAISGOB..Translation of Luguid son of ...? descent of Nad-Segamon' (Ogham 3D) NETA-SEGAMONAS a local dynasty likely active in w Waterford 5th–7th c. The name appears on stones also at Kilgrovan Island & possibly Knockboy

Crotty's Cave, Comeragh Mountains
A historic photograph c1900 shows unidentified men at Crotty’s Cave in the infamous hideout of William Crotty, notorious highwayman. The chamber, hidden beneath Crotty’s Rock. On 18 March 1742, he was hanged, and his severed head was displayed above Waterford gaol.
